Brentford vs Everton - Tactical Analysis & Betting Verdict

As we approach this Premier League clash at the Gtech Community Stadium, we're presented with a fascinating tactical battle between two teams with contrasting styles but similar vulnerabilities. Brentford, under Thomas Frank, have established themselves as one of the league's most tactically flexible sides, while Everton under Sean Dyche have embraced a pragmatic, defensively-organized approach. What makes this matchup particularly intriguing from a betting perspective is the convergence of attacking intent and defensive fragility that suggests goals at both ends. While both teams have shown resilience at times, their recent performances reveal patterns that point strongly toward both teams finding the net in this encounter.

Tactical Overview

Brentford's tactical identity under Thomas Frank has evolved into a sophisticated hybrid system that combines their traditional direct approach with more possession-based phases. They typically deploy a 3-5-2 or 4-3-3 formation that allows them to transition quickly from defense to attack, with Ivan Toney's physical presence and Bryan Mbeumo's pace creating constant problems for opposition defenses. Their pressing triggers are well-drilled, particularly in central areas, which forces turnovers in dangerous positions. However, their defensive structure has shown vulnerabilities this season, especially in transition when their wing-backs push forward, leaving space behind that quality opponents can exploit.

Everton under Sean Dyche have embraced a more pragmatic 4-4-1-1 or 4-5-1 system that prioritizes defensive solidity and set-piece efficiency. Their approach is built around compact defensive blocks, aggressive pressing in midfield, and direct ball progression to Dominic Calvert-Lewin or Beto. While they've improved defensively under Dyche, they remain vulnerable to teams that can move the ball quickly through midfield, which Brentford's dynamic midfield trio of Jensen, Nørgaard, and Janelt can certainly do. Everton's attacking threat comes primarily from crosses and set pieces, with Dwight McNeil and Jack Harrison providing quality delivery from wide areas. This creates a fascinating tactical dynamic where Brentford's high defensive line could be exposed by Everton's direct approach, while Everton's compact defense will be tested by Brentford's intricate passing combinations.

Key Player Impact & Team News

For Brentford, the return of Ivan Toney has transformed their attacking potency. His combination of physical presence, intelligent movement, and clinical finishing makes him a constant threat, particularly against Everton's physical but sometimes positionally suspect center-backs. Bryan Mbeumo's pace and direct running complement Toney perfectly, creating one of the league's most effective strike partnerships. In midfield, Christian Nørgaard's defensive screening will be crucial against Everton's physical midfield, while Mathias Jensen's creativity could unlock Everton's organized defense. Defensively, Brentford have concerns with Rico Henry and Aaron Hickey both long-term absentees, forcing them to use less natural options at wing-back, which Everton's wide players could exploit.

Everton's attacking fortunes largely depend on Dominic Calvert-Lewin's fitness and form. When available, his aerial dominance and hold-up play provide the focal point for their direct approach. Abdoulaye Doucouré's late runs from midfield have been a significant source of goals this season, while Dwight McNeil's delivery from set pieces and open play creates constant danger. Defensively, James Tarkowski and Jarrad Branthwaite have formed a solid partnership, but both have shown susceptibility to quick, technical forwards like Mbeumo. In midfield, Idrissa Gueye's energy and tackling will be crucial in disrupting Brentford's rhythm, while Amadou Onana's physical presence could dominate the aerial battles. Everton's injury concerns are relatively minor compared to Brentford's, giving them a slight advantage in squad depth.

Statistical Trends (H2H, Recent Form)

Historical data between these sides reveals a pattern of both teams scoring. In their last five Premier League meetings, both teams have scored in four matches, with an average of 3.2 goals per game. Brentford have scored in 12 of their last 13 home Premier League matches, demonstrating their attacking consistency at the Gtech Community Stadium. However, they've kept just two clean sheets in their last 10 home games, highlighting their defensive vulnerabilities. Everton's away form shows similar patterns - they've scored in 8 of their last 10 away matches but have kept only three clean sheets in that period.

Recent form analysis strengthens the case for both teams scoring. Brentford have seen both teams score in 7 of their last 10 Premier League matches, while Everton have had both teams score in 6 of their last 10. Both teams have shown defensive fragility in recent weeks - Brentford have conceded in 8 consecutive matches across all competitions, while Everton have kept just one clean sheet in their last seven away games. The underlying statistics are equally compelling: Brentford average 1.4 expected goals (xG) per home game but concede 1.6 xG, while Everton average 1.2 xG away but concede 1.8 xG. These numbers suggest both teams create enough quality chances to score while being vulnerable defensively.
